← ScienceWhich mechanism causes increased speckle contrast when an endoscopic OCT system's tunable laser scans tissue?
A)Rayleigh scattering dominates interference
B)Constructive interference varies randomly✓
C)Brewster's angle effect is amplified
D)Fresnel diffraction blurs details
💡 Explanation
Increased speckle occurs when multiple scattering points coherently interfere. Speckle contrast rises because coherent interference between these scatterers becomes highly sensitive to tiny positional or wavelength changes, therefore speckle varies randomly, rather than being simply a result of scattering amplitude or simple image blur.
